Teaching Assistant | Hammersmith, W6 | 90-105 | Long-Term to Permanent | September 2024

We are seeking a compassionate and dedicated Teaching Assistant to join our partner school's support staff team in Hammersmith, supporting a child in Year 1 who has Non-Verbal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D). This role involves providing essential support to ensure the child's educational and personal development within the school environment.

Responsibilities:

  • Assist in implementing individualized education and behaviour plans under the guidance of the SENCO and class teacher.
  • Support the child during classroom activities, ensuring inclusion and participation.
  • Provide personal care assistance as required, maintaining dignity and respect at all times.
  • Foster a positive and supportive learning environment, employing strategies to promote communication and social interaction.
  • Monitor and record progress, contributing to ongoing assessments and reviews.

Requirements:

  • Experience working with children with ASD or similar special educational needs.
  • Understanding of non-verbal communication methods and augmentative communication systems.
  • Patience, empathy, and the ability to build rapport with children and colleagues.
  • Flexibility to adapt support strategies based on individual needs and responses.
  • Relevant qualifications or willingness to undergo training as necessary.
